In a beta update to its iOS, Apple has removed the default female voice for Siri and instead will let users choose the voice of their choice right when setting up the device. With this, the tech major also brings two new voice options to its English-speaking users.
In a new beta update for iOS, Apple has released two new English voices for its smart assistant Siri. The company has also removed the default Siri voice and will now let users select the voice of their choice for the AI assistant right at the time of setting up their Apple device. Apple says that its decision to remove a default voice from Siri is in line with its commitment towards diversity and inclusion. It is just another example of how the Cupertino tech major aims to steer its products and services to reflect the diversity in the world. The update is currently seen in a new beta version of iOS available to participants of the program. In the stable versions to date, Siri used a female voice as default for responding to any queries/ actions. In some countries, however, the voice option is set to male by default.More Related News
